The UniOP eTOP03, eTOP05, eTOP10, and eTOP11 series represent a robust lineup of human-machine interface (HMI) solutions tailored for demanding environments such as the power industry, petrochemical plants, and general automation systems. Designed to deliver reliable operation, these models combine high input/output capacity, advanced durability, and superior performance metrics to meet rigorous industrial standards.

Each model in this series offers distinct technical features optimized for specific application needs. The UniOP eTOP03 and eTOP05 are compact units that provide versatile input/output configurations, supporting multiple communication protocols to ensure seamless integration with PLCs and controllers. Their display units, typically ranging from 3.5 to 5.7 inches, feature high-resolution touchscreens designed for clear visualization and intuitive operator control. The eTOP10 and eTOP11 models expand on this foundation with larger displays and enhanced processing power, offering increased memory capacity and faster response times. These enhancements allow for more complex graphical interfaces and the ability to handle extensive data logging and alarm management, critical in power generation and petrochemical processes where real-time monitoring is essential.

Durability is a cornerstone of the eTOP03, eTOP05, eTOP10, and eTOP11 series. Built with industrial-grade materials, these HMIs withstand harsh environments characterized by extreme temperatures, humidity, and dust, common in petrochemical plants and power stations. Their robust IP65-rated front panels provide protection against water and dust ingress, ensuring uninterrupted operation. Additionally, their long lifecycle support and backward compatibility with earlier UniOP models like the eTOP10C-0050 and eTOP11-0050 make them a reliable choice for long-term projects.

In real-world scenarios, the application of eTOP03 eTOP05 eTOP10 eTOP11 in the power industry is particularly notable. These HMIs facilitate effective control and monitoring of power distribution systems, allowing operators to visualize load parameters, manage alarms, and ensure system stability. In petrochemical environments, their ability to interface with various sensors and actuators enables precise control over complex chemical processes, improving safety and efficiency. General automation systems benefit from the flexibility of these models, as their scalable input/output options and customizable interfaces support a wide range of machinery and process control tasks.
